    N/AAutodesk Docs is a cloud-based common data environment for Autodesk's AEC Collection and the Autodesk Construction Cloud. The solution helps to reduce errors, streamline review and approval workflows, as well as align team members to ease project scheduling.

    Cons
    Autodesk
    • It is a bit expensive for small construction companies or project offices, and it is more difficult to reach, especially for countries with high exchange rates such as Turkey.
    • It cannot integrate with other non-Autodesk software we use within the company.
    • Being dependent on the internet is a problem. Of course, I know that being cloudy requires internet, but it may be an advantage to at least keep the used files in its own memory for a while.
